Hi Gordon, Comments were all over the map but basically: 1) Everybody agrees unique format for code development is needed. 2) Many objected to the idea of mixing code development and analysis 3) Adam Lyon in particular was vocal in opposing code development in some root tree format other than edm root 4) Aurelio did not agree. 5) Marco said we should speed up thumbnail and improve linking time and if that is not possible go for edm root. 6) Some consensus that common root format for analysis would be nice but many worried about creating yet another new format to enforce uniformity. Aurelio was adamant that we be very careful not to add more problems to the ones we already have.
